Donaldson, William ; Young, Douglas (Editors): ''Grampian Hairst. An Anthology of Northeast Prose''.
Aberdeen University Press 1981. xvi + 206pp. Brown boards. VG in slightly scuffed dustwrapper. [prose extracts, mainly fictional, from the works of 31 authors, mostly dating from the mid-19th century up to 1980. Includes an essay on 'Northeast Scots as a Literary Language' by David Murison and brief biographical notes on the authors represented]. (Book ref. 2729) £10.00

Wallace, Ian Reflections on Scotland
Norwich: Jarrolds, 1988 First edition. Red cloth, gilt, maps, many col photos Pagination: 224. Reflections on Scotland is a beguiling and highly individual book, documenting a great many curious and unusual buildings, monuments and mementoes. Interspersed throughout the book is a series of affectionate memories of Ian Wallace’s Scottish family and childhood, with a wry appreciation of the land of his forefathers, not to mention their dry, or even downright ironic wit and humour.<P>It is a country with an exciting, proud and turbulent past, crowded with warrior heroes and kings, poets and musicians. Robert Burns, Robert Louis Stevenson, Sir Walter Scott and countless others all found inspiration in the land of their birth, and Scotland must surely be celebrated in both verse and song more than anywhere else.<P>Naturally enough there are several tales stemming from Ian Wallace’s extraordinary varied career as both actor and singer, now in its forty-fourth year. He has worked for close on forty of those years in Scotland, and for all of them he has been married to a girl from Fife.<P>From the shores of the Solway and the isolated splendour of the Isle of Skye, to the tranquillity of the grounds of Melrose Abbey and the glories of Edinburgh, Reflections on Scotland covers over 200 locations, with magnificent colour photographs, specially commissioned for publication. It is a book for both specialist and general reader alike and will win Ian Wallace countless new admirers. Contents: Introduction; Dumfries and Galloway; Strathclyde; Glasgow; Central; Highland; Islands; Grampian; Tayside; Fife; Edinburgh; Lothian; Borders; Useful maps; General index; Acknowledgements.
